Transaction 946fa5ca6efbb9bf6840c1724c6d3aacc669c870e8ab367c00366670270ecc8b
1 Input
1 Output
-
946fa5ca6efbb9bf6840c1724c6d3aacc669c870e8ab367c00366670270ecc8b:0
- value
- 27907
- script pubkey
- OP_0 OP_PUSHBYTES_20 e283d34cc3e8f25f7d5171b53a53afc3caad155c
- address
- bc1qu2paxnxrare97l23wx6n55a0c092692ultehaa